bersenev-98
Новичок
Здравствуйте уважаемые форумчане) Собственно вот какие возникли вопросы:
1. Как должна выглядеть полноценная маршрутизация на сайте? Что обязательно должно в ней быть, как проверять url на безопасность и т.д. Конкретно интересует маршрутизация сайта, построенного по принципу MVC. Знаю что нужно разбивать адрес на сегменты, но как правильно должен выглядеть адрес? (Например "/контроллер/действие/параметр").
2. Для чего служат базовые контроллеры и зачем остальным контроллерам наследовать их свойства?
P.S. Если не трудно, то пожалуйста скиньте ссылку на какую-нибудь полезную статью. И пожалуйста не надо меня убеждать не изобретать велосипед и использовать фреймворки. Ведь чтобы уметь правильно пользоваться фреймворком, надо хорошо знать как он работает)) Заранее благодарен.
1. Как должна выглядеть полноценная маршрутизация на сайте? Что обязательно должно в ней быть, как проверять url на безопасность и т.д. Конкретно интересует маршрутизация сайта, построенного по принципу MVC. Знаю что нужно разбивать адрес на сегменты, но как правильно должен выглядеть адрес? (Например "/контроллер/действие/параметр").
2. Для чего служат базовые контроллеры и зачем остальным контроллерам наследовать их свойства?
P.S. Если не трудно, то пожалуйста скиньте ссылку на какую-нибудь полезную статью. И пожалуйста не надо меня убеждать не изобретать велосипед и использовать фреймворки. Ведь чтобы уметь правильно пользоваться фреймворком, надо хорошо знать как он работает)) Заранее благодарен.